Transaction 12fb7225a79ebeb3b1ef507ef49bfc9919b0b80274740b824c8e2a993ececc56

2 Input
2 Outputs
  • 12fb7225a79ebeb3b1ef507ef49bfc9919b0b80274740b824c8e2a993ececc56:0
  • value  16602328
    address  3G7CtBmua5QcSNezPvZMM318TzJKZP3aDC
  • 12fb7225a79ebeb3b1ef507ef49bfc9919b0b80274740b824c8e2a993ececc56:1
  • value  58365750
    address  1AbrNLYnFQ9vsPEBLPeR46K6FNmiSrQh5y